Grammar Patterns
a verse from ((sth.)) a short division of a text. He read a verse from the Bible.
in verse as poetry. The story was told in verse.
a verse of ((a song)) a stanza of a song. I only know the first verse of the song.

Etymology
From Latin 'versus' meaning 'a line of writing', literally 'a turning', from 'vertere' 'to turn'. The idea is turning from one line to the next.
